Louisiana Statutes

§ 9:4111 — Written settlement agreements

Louisiana·Title 9 Civil Code-Ancillaries
A.If, as a result of a mediation, the parties agree to settle and execute a written agreement disposing of the dispute, the agreement is enforceable as any other transaction or compromise and is governed by the provisions of Title XVII of Book III of the Civil Code, to the extent not in conflict with the provisions of this Chapter.
B.The court in its discretion may incorporate the terms of the agreement in the court's final decree disposing of the case.
